Matter pairing offered in macOS app, but app cannot complete the pairing
Device model, version and app version
Model Name: MacBook Pro 14-inch, 2021 macOS Version: Sequoia 15.5 App Version: 2025.1264 Safari Version: 18.5 (20621.2.5.11.8)
(Latest stable software as of today)
Home Assistant Core Version
2025.6.3
(Latest stable software as of today)
Describe the bug
When adding a new Matter device, the macOS app is shown as available, but the app cannot complete the pairing.
To Reproduce
Settings > Integration > {Add Integration}. Pick "Add Matter Device", then "No. It's new."
Expected behaviour
Friendly error that says "You need to use the Home Assistant Companion app on your mobile phone to add Matter devices.", like when you do that in a browser
Actual behaviour
Brief Home Assistant logo flash, then thrown back to the Integrations screen

Additional context
The detection for the "You need to use the Home Assistant Companion App" message probably detects the macOS app as the companion app.
